简单优雅的python绘图
biggles的Python项目详细描述
biggles是一个python模块,用于创建发布质量2d scientific 阴谋。它支持多种输出格式(postscript、x11、png、svg、gif)。 了解简单的tex,并运动一个高级,优雅的界面。是的 专为有复杂绘图需求的技术用户设计。
简单示例
下面是一个简单的biggles脚本:
>>> import biggles >>> x = [1, 2, 3, 4, 5] >>> y = [5, 4, 3, 2, 1] >>> p = biggles.FramedPlot() >>> p.add(biggles.Curve(x, y)) >>> p.show()
这将生成一个x窗口,其中包含曲线y(x)的框架图。 你可以在examples中找到更多 源发行版中包含的目录。另外,请参见gallery 在网上。
有关详细信息,请参阅完整的documentation。
安装
macports:
$ sudo port install plotutils +x11 $ pip install biggles
自制:
$ brew install plotutils --with-x11 $ pip install biggles
debian/ubuntu:
$ sudo apt-get libplot-dev plotutils $ pip install biggles
windows
这种安装目前没有经过很好的测试。如果你发现了虫子,请报告!